Let's start with price to earnings growth. Decades ago, Peter Lynch claimed that a PEG of 1 was a fair price. Partly because interest rates are now lower and partly because there is even more demand for stocks than in Lynch's time, the typical PEG is now about 1.3 instead of 1. The PEG Ratio divides the forward P/E by its projected growth rate.

Nvidia's projected rate of growth is about 50% annually and its current forward P/E is about 25 ... so, 25/50 =0.5. (The 0.6 in the table above uses more precise, and slightly different numbers to arrive at 0.6 instead of 0.5. Any given day you could plug in new numbers and end up with a slightly different value. The stock market is hardly precise in its valuations that literally change minute to minute but for our purposes, 0.5 or 0.6 are essentially the same.) Price to earnings growth for Nvidia suggests that you're paying a low price for future earnings.

To buy Tesla, by contrast, means paying a really high price for future earnings. Analysts are projecting fairly healthy growth rates for Tesla. Annual earnings growth of about 30 to 35% - if realized - is really impressive. But investors have driven up the price of Tesla to the point that they are paying about $180 for every dollar of future earnings, so the current P/E is about 180. 180 divided by 35 (projected earnings growth rate) and you get a PEG of about 5. This suggests that you're paying a remarkably high price for future earnings.

Put aside the servers for a moment and focus instead just on Nvidia's plans for cars. Nvidia is equipping companies like Toyota & Lexus, Jaguar Land Rover, General Motors, Hyundai Motor Group, Geely, Nissan, Mercedes-Benz, Volvo Cars, Li Auto, Lucid Motors, Xiaomi EV, JLR, and Isuzu with their Orin processor and more advanced Thor chip and self-driving system. Nvidia's Drive Thor platform is a centralized car computer that integrates autonomous driving, AI cockpit features, passenger entertainment, and safety systems into a single architecture. Additionally, Nvidia is working with a variety of autonomous trucking and robotaxis manufacturers.

Nvidia will handle the training of this self-driving capability and provide the integrated chip and self-driving system for these (and likely many other) car companies. Any one of these companies might fade into bankruptcy or become the newly dominant car company. Nvidia will have a diversified investment in these companies. Some will sell far more cars in this new world of self-driving cars. Some will sell fewer. Nvidia will sell to them all and because of this is almost certain to do well even as individual companies find their own fortunes rise and fall.
